LocationHOBOKEN, NJCareer AreaData Analytics and Business IntelligenceJob FunctionData ScienceEmployment TypeRegular/PermanentPosition TypeSalaryRequisitionWD1816635 What you'll do at Position Summary...What you'll do...Walmart Global Tech is seeking a talented and experienced Principal Data Scientist specializing in Pricing Algorithms to lead our efforts in developing sophisticated pricing models and strategies
As a Principal Data Scientist, you will play a critical role in driving innovation and optimizing revenue through the application of advanced statistical and machine learning techniques
You will lead a team of data scientists and collaborate closely with cross-functional teams to develop and implement pricing algorithms that maximize profitability and drive business growth.About Team: Our Merchandise AI Team within Applied AI group is the driving force behind our retail and e-commerce success, leveraging cutting-edge AI and machine learning techniques to optimize every aspect of our merchandising strategy
With a diverse blend of expertise in statistical analysis, machine learning algorithms, and retail operations, our team pioneers innovative solutions across the merchandising lifecycle, from demand forecasting and assortment planning to pricing optimization
We're dedicated to building algorithms that empower stakeholders throughout the organization to make informed, data-driven decisions, ensuring that we stay ahead of the curve in an ever-evolving retail landscape. What you'll do: Strategic Leadership: Provide strategic leadership and technical expertise in the development and implementation of pricing algorithms and models
Define the vision, roadmap, and priorities for pricing optimization initiatives
Algorithm Development: Lead the design, development, and deployment of advanced pricing algorithms using state-of-the-art machine learning techniques, including but not limited to regression analysis, demand forecasting, dynamic pricing, and reinforcement learning
Code Review: Conduct thorough code reviews of pricing algorithms and related software components developed by the team
Ensure adherence to best practices, coding standards, and optimization techniques
Provide constructive feedback and mentorship to team members to enhance code quality and maintainability
Data Analysis and Insights: Utilize large datasets to conduct in-depth analysis of customer behavior, market dynamics, and competitive pricing strategies
Extract actionable insights to inform pricing decisions and strategy formulation
Model Evaluation and Optimization: Oversee the evaluation, validation, and optimization of pricing models to ensure accuracy, reliability, and performance
Implement rigorous testing methodologies to assess model effectiveness and robustness
Collaboration and Stakeholder Engagement: Collaborate closely with cross-functional teams including product management, engineering, marketing, and finance to understand business objectives, requirements, and constraints
Work collaboratively to translate business needs into data-driven pricing solutions
Thought Leadership: Stay abreast of industry trends, best practices, and emerging technologies in pricing analytics, data science, and machine learning
Provide thought leadership and guidance on pricing strategy, methodologies, and implementation best practices
Documentation and Communication: Document methodologies, findings, and recommendations in clear and concise manner
Communicate complex technical concepts and insights to non-technical stakeholders through presentations, reports, and dashboards
Mentorship and Knowledge Sharing: Mentor junior team members and provide guidance on technical and methodological aspects of pricing analytics and data science
Foster a culture of learning and knowledge sharing within the team

Hoboken, New Jersey US-10279:The annual salary range for this position is $132,000.00-$264,000.00 Bentonville, Arkansas US-09416:The annual salary range for this position is $110,000.00-$220,000.00 Additional compensation includes annual or quarterly performance bonuses. Additional compensation for certain positions may also include: - Stock Minimum Qualifications...Outlined below are the required minimum qualifications for this position
If none are listed, there are no minimum qualifications
Option 1: Bachelors degree in Statistics, Economics, Analytics, Mathematics, Computer Science, Information Technology or related field and 5 years' experience in an analytics related field
Option 2: Masters degree in Statistics, Economics, Analytics, Mathematics, Computer Science, Information Technology or related field and 3 years' experience in an analytics related field
Option 3: 7 years' experience in an analytics or related fieldPreferred Qualifications...Outlined below are the optional preferred qualifications for this position
